Job summary

WSP USA seeks a Lead Professional, Signal Engineer-CBTC to join our Transit and Rail/Systems Engineering teams in NY/NJ offices including Lawrenceville. You will drive CBTC migration projects, review mixed-mode signaling designs, and ensure safety-compliant interlocking logic and test procedures.

The role requires deep expertise in CBTC and fixed-block systems, collaboration with NYCT operations, and liaison with suppliers and designers to achieve reliable, safe signaling solutions.

Qualifications

  • Bachelor’s degree in electrical, systems, or railway engineering.
  • 7+ years of experience in fixed-block and/or CBTC signaling.
  • Experience reviewing and coordinating block design packages for mixed-mode signaling.
  • Experience developing or reviewing interlocking logic test procedures and software state machines.
  • Understanding NYCT signal principles and legacy control systems.
  • Familiarity with interlocking design standards and CBTC interfaces.

Responsibilities

  • Provide technical review and approval of block design drawings for mixed-mode operation.
  • Liaise between CBTC supplier, designer, and NYCT operations on signal design and block approval.
  • Review interlocking logic implementation in relay-based and CBTC subsystems.
  • Approve test procedures for interlocking logic and signal control sequences.
  • Evaluate software state machines used for interlocking in CBTC systems.
  • Ensure interoperability, safety, and maintainability during migration to CBTC.
  • Support interface alignment between CBTC zone controllers, relays, and field equipment.
  • Participate in design and field reviews with NYCT teams.
  • Track and report design deliverables and test progress.
